- Weak Signal: If the signal is weak, try adjusting your antenna. Make sure it is properly aligned and positioned for optimal reception. You may also need to upgrade to a more powerful antenna.
- Interference: Interference from other electronic devices can disrupt the digital signal. Try moving your TV or antenna away from potential sources of interference, such as microwave ovens or mobile phones.
- Incorrect Settings: Double-check that your TV or STB is set to the correct region and language. Incorrect settings can sometimes cause issues with channel scanning.
- Outdated Firmware: Make sure your TV or STB has the latest firmware installed. Manufacturers often release updates to improve performance and fix bugs. Check the device’s settings menu for an option to update the firmware.

Understanding Digital TV Transition in Jogja
The transition from analog to digital TV broadcasting has brought significant improvements in picture and sound quality. No more fuzzy screens or annoying static! However, it also means that you need to ensure your TV is compatible with digital signals and that you have the correct frequency information for each channel.
In Jogja, like other regions in Indonesia, the government has been actively pushing for this transition to provide a better viewing experience for everyone. This shift requires viewers to either have a TV with a built-in digital tuner or use an external set-top box (STB) to receive digital signals. Once you have the necessary equipment, the next step is to find the right frequency for your favorite channels, including RCTI.
